From: SourceForge.net <no...@so...> - 2010-01-24 13:06:43
|
Bugs item #2938552, was opened at 2010-01-24 14:29 Message generated for change (Comment added) made by lalesculiviu You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=102435&aid=2938552&group_id=2435 Please note that this message will contain a full copy of the comment thread, including the initial issue submission, for this request, not just the latest update. Category: MinGW Group: None Status: Open Resolution: None Priority: 5 Private: No Submitted By: Volker Dirr (volker_dirr) Assigned to: Nobody/Anonymous (nobody) Summary: internal error: Segmentation faul Initial Comment: Sorry guys for this bad bug report, but it is so nasty. I compiled this source on different computers: http://www.timetabling.de/download/fet-5.12.1.tar.bz2 i can compile it under windows vista, linux, ... but i also have 2 computers i can't compile the source. i got a "internal error: Segmentation faul. Please submit full bug report." in ..\engine\timetableexport.cpp:7019 i don't know how to go on. it is a windows xp computer with 640 MB ram, but during compiling only 330 mb ram is used. it use gcc 4.4.0 with qt 4.6. (but i also use that gcc 4.4.0 and qt 4.6 on an other windows vista and it work fine on that computer.) i got a report from an other guy, that he has similar problems with an windows xp (but on an amd 4200 dual core with 1 gb ram.) he told me that sometimes just modifiing/deleting comments in the source "help". i don't understand that bug. i hope you can give me an hint or we maybe found a stupid bug. regards volker ps: (if file is not longer available, file is already moved to http://www.timetabling.de/download/old/fet-5.12.1.tar.bz2 ) ---------------------------------------------------------------------- Comment By: Lalescu Liviu (lalesculiviu) Date: 2010-01-24 15:06 Message: Also, I forgot to say: we are using the MinGW that comes with Qt SDK 4.6.1 or 4.6.0. It is a MinGW with gcc 4.4.0, possibly modified by Qt team. ---------------------------------------------------------------------- Comment By: Lalescu Liviu (lalesculiviu) Date: 2010-01-24 15:03 Message: Line 7019 is: QString TimetableExport::writeActivitiesRooms(const QList<qint16>& allActivities){ Sometimes it crashes on other 3 lines: there are another 3 lines similar to this one (6848, 6930 and 7076). In rare cases it compiles, depends on luck. Removing the "const" keyword seems to solve the problem. Also, changing "qint16" to "int" solves the problem (this is a hack I made to solve the problem, temporarily). 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=102435&aid=2938552&group_id=2435 |